The Importance of Surety Agreement Bonds



You require to comprehend the significance of Surety contract bonds as a service provider.

Surety contract bonds play a crucial function in the building and construction market. These bonds supply financial defense and guarantee to project owners that you, as a contractor, will certainly fulfill your legal responsibilities.

By acquiring a Surety bond, you're essentially guaranteeing that you'll complete the project according to the conditions specified in the agreement. This provides peace of mind to project proprietors, as they know they'll be compensated if you stop working to fulfill your commitments.

Additionally, Surety bonds additionally show your reliability and credibility as a specialist. They serve as a kind of recognition that you have the needed certifications, experience, and financial stability to undertake the job effectively.

Understanding the Kinds Of Surety Agreement Bonds



To totally understand the sorts of Surety agreement bonds, specialists need to familiarize themselves with the various alternatives offered.

There are three major sorts of Surety contract bonds that contractors ought to know: quote bonds, performance bonds, and payment bonds.

This bond ensures that if the contractor is awarded the project, they'll participate in a contract and offer the necessary efficiency and settlement bonds.

Efficiency bonds guarantee that the specialist will finish the job according to the regards to the agreement.

Repayment bonds secure subcontractors and vendors by making certain that they'll be spent for their service the task.

Steps to Acquire Surety Contract Bonds



To acquire Surety agreement bonds, contractors must follow a series of steps to ensure their eligibility and safeguard the required bonding.

The primary step is to analyze your financial standing. Surety bond providers will examine your economic stability, credit report, and previous job experience to establish if you fulfill their underwriting needs.

The second action is to choose a reliable Surety bond supplier. Study different providers, contrast their rates, and consider their expertise in the construction sector.



When you have actually chosen a provider, you'll need to complete an application and send it with the essential sustaining files. These files might include economic declarations, work experience records, and recommendations.

After reviewing your application, the Surety bond supplier will identify your bond quantity and provide the bond if you're authorized.

It is very important to begin this process early to ensure you have the needed bonding in place before beginning any building jobs.
